Abstract

The utility model provides a kind of induction energy fetching formula outdoor intelligent breaker, comprise breaker body, described body is arranged power module, control module and sampling module, described control module is connected with power module respectively with described sampling module, described control module comprises singlechip controller, signal processing module and intelligent drives controller, is connected between described control module with described sampling module by transport module; Described power module comprises induction energy fetching device and batteries.This device can realize cut-offfing line load and isolated fault function, realizes control operation on the spot and realizes remote control operation by the instruction of front-end acquisition device receiving system; Performance data collection can not only be completed, i.e. the data such as Real-time Collection circuit three-phase current, voltage, circuit-breaker status; Long-range fault alarm can also be realized, by detection line phase fault, single phase ground fault send fault message to automation main website.

Background technology
Along with the progress of expanding economy, society, the raising of science and technology and the level of IT application, the exploitation of the energy, the coordinated development of electrical network are faced with new problem and new challenge.Rely on present information, communication and control technology, improve the trend that electrical network intelligent level is future development.For this reason, each power supply enterprise all accelerates the step generation of electric network information, automation, interactive construction, dragon its in distribution network automated, upgrading work is very urgent.
In the construction of distribution automation system, the low-tension supply problem of automation equipment is a large bottleneck of lines escalation transformation always; Conventional scheme electromagnetic potential transformer power taking, in engineering pass is executed, need independent lifting, wiring, both increased engineering construction amount, easily there is wiring error in sky again; Also have scheme to be utilize high-tension current inductor or solar panel power taking, but this scheme may be subject to the impact of weather and load variations in actual use, power supply supply is unstable, limits the development of power distribution automation.
Current general outdoor primary cut-out is formed by normal circuit breaker, controller, power transformer, the switch of this pattern, during the control wiring of power transformer first and second terminal box, controller is all exposed to outdoor severe cold, extremely hot, strong wind, thunderstorm, failure rate is high, poor reliability.During conducting transmission line maintenance, need divide-shut brake manually, automaticity is low, is difficult to the basic demand reaching intelligent grid.When after 10KV line outage, when comprising the transient fault that some cause due to weather, passage reason, also must carry out artificial inspection and carry out the localization of faults and fault type carries out malfunction elimination, then manual reclosing is carried out, restore electricity, the shortcoming of this troubleshooting pattern is that the handling failure time is longer, and economic benefit and social benefit are not mated, and limit the development of distribution automation.
So outdoor high voltage circuit breaker, as one of control and protection equipment most important in electric power system, is faced with and gets source inconvenience, high-tension current inductor and easily open by mistake the shortcomings such as road, breaking-closing operating driving mechanism resistance to impact are weak; If reequiped on the basis of plain edition outdoor vacuum circuit breaker merely, just need to install the equipment such as power subsystem, current transformer, automation data interface and front-end acquisition device additional, the number of devices related to is more, organizes and coordinates complexity, and in-site installation quantities is large.

In the specific implementation, open circuit supervising device adopts three-phase column support type structure, there is break performance reliable and stable, without burning and explosion hazard, safety, non-maintaining, volume is little, the features such as lightweight and long service life, adopt full-closed structure, good seal performance, there is protection against the tide, anti-condensation performance, be adapted to severe cold or the use of hot humid area especially, three-phase pillar inside increases full skirt, cut off the direct range of primary circuit and casing, creepage distance is increased greatly, the outsourcing of outside primary line terminal increases climbs full skirt, outside fracture creepage distance is made to increase to more than 600MM, meet height above sea level less than 3500 meters area to use, install outdoor disconnector additional and circuit breaker forms integration, circuit breaker and isolating switch have reliable mechanical interlocks.
Power module comprises energy taking device and batteries, and energy taking device is induction energy fetching device, comprises the rectification stable pressuring unit of plate condenser and connection thereof, and plate condenser is arranged in the alternating electric field of high-voltage operation circuit.Induction energy fetching technology is applied in device, on the one hand, decrease complexity and the degree of difficulty of supply source, can make rational use of resources, on the other hand, in the power supply unit of induction energy fetching, add rectification stable pressuring unit, rectification stable pressuring unit comprises rectifier and reducing transformer, this power conversion, by collecting the high-tension line coupling energy produced in electric field environment, is become the output of well-tuned, for power supply component assembly provides energy by low-loss rectifier and efficient voltage reducing type transducer; Voltage regulation unit can effectively be avoided circuit element to get under big current absorbing energy surplus and scaling loss power circuit by unit; reduce the caloric value of power supply; and unnecessary absorbing energy effectively is stored; rectification stable pressuring unit can also connect protection electric capacity; can prevent getting energy unit saturated, and enable to get and can send momentary high power by unit, strengthen draw-out power supply carrying load ability and adaptive capacity.
As the intelligent kernel parts of the outdoor open circuit supervising device of power distribution network, control module comprises singlechip controller, signal processing module and intelligent drives controller, wherein, singlechip controller comprises singlechip chip and data acquisition unit, singlechip chip is as microprocessor, need that there is higher performance, to realize the real-time measurement of external signal and to reach sensitive control ability.Therefore can adopt classics 8 single-chip microcomputer PICl6F877 of Microchip company, its inside is changed with several functions module: A/D, and PWM controls, timer etc., be a kind of numerous function i ntegration to chip together, realize hardware circuit software implementation, reduce costs, improve system reliability.
Signal processing module is mainly in order to tackle normal circuit breaker when replacing device processed, likely there is the situation that Current Transformer Secondary is opened a way, at this moment current transformer primary current all becomes exciting current, the magnetic flux density of iron core is made sharply to increase, thus induce the induced potential up to thousands of volt in secondary winding, danger may be caused to operating personnel, the utility model device is through safety and Protection, the outlet of all current transformers all have passed through the two times transfer process of low-voltage current mutual inductor and buck converter in base, thoroughly can avoid the problem of the mutual device second open circuit of electric current, ensure the safety of mounting operator.
Intelligent drives controller mainly comprises voltage detection module, storage capacitor and device for power switching, and for monitoring performance and the voltage of breaker energy storage capacitor, be in the operating mechanism of primary cut-out, condenser voltage testing circuit comprises linear optical coupling; Under linear optical coupling is operated in photovoltage pattern, the linearity can reach 12 precision, and operating frequency is 40kHz to the maximum.Voltage on energy storage capacitor, by electric resistance partial pressure, obtains the voltage signal that amplitude is less than 15V, and this signal is input linear light-coupled isolation hop after follower drives.First the voltage signal exported at secondary side passes through RC circuit filtering high-frequency signal, then through ferrite bean L2 filtering digital noise, finally inputs singlechip chip; Device for power switching is insulated gate bipolar transistor, and its operation principle is: driver carries out Real-Time Monitoring to storage capacitor voltage.If undertension, charge: the separating brake that control far away/nearly control or host computer transmit if receive or reclosing command, first judge whether the whether correct condenser voltage in the position of circuit breaker reaches preset value.Conform to, drive that IGBT carries out point, closing operation.When arrival point, closing position or to have exceeded point, the combined floodgate predetermined registration operation time then turns off IGBT immediately, stops dividing, closing operation, circuit breaker position is uploaded to upper control module.So this special working mechanism requires that real-time is stronger, particularly dividing, in making process.Accurate commutation control need be realized, in practical operation, when voltage is lower than preset value, be capacitor charging by power module, otherwise then stop charging, monitor electrical network parameter and circuit-breaker status simultaneously, corresponding parameter display is exported, be convenient to through the interconnected and compositing area network of transmission between open circuit supervising device, in the network by the host computer interface of Surveillance center control circuit breaker point, close a floodgate, the operation conditions of each circuit breaker in monitoring network simultaneously.
Transport module comprises serial communication unit, serial communication unit comprises RS485 serial communication interface circuit, when circuit breaker forms monitoring circuit breaker network, device will upload on middle control main frame the status signal of the parameter of electrical network, capacitance voltage value, circuit breaker in time, because distance is larger, so industrial conventional Rs-485 can be adopted to communicate, there is transmission range length, speed is higher, level capacitive is good, flexible and convenient to use, with low cost and reliability advantages of higher, all have a wide range of applications in many fields such as intelligent management, On-line Control, geological prospectings.
